The Gallipoli campaign of WW1 not only involved British and French forces invading the coast of Turkey but also involved the nearby Greek Island of Lemnos. It was in the mighty Mudros harbour that the invasion fleet gathered and it was here where wounded soldiers were treated, in their 100's of 1,000's. It was also seen as the only place where troops could rest and recuperate away from the horrible trenches. There are many dusty, grainy photographs of the troops exploring these windmills. Now they are just ruins of the same.

Craig Roach or more commonly known as Roachie, has wandered the secluded and stunningly beautiful WW1 battlefield of Gallipoli for thirty years. In that time he has seen nature slowly taking back the scars and tragedies of war. Roachie, has always been an avid artist and has passionately devoted his life on creating an artistic legacy of this tragic but beautiful place.

The hills, gullies, old trenches and beaches are littered with the remains of WW1. A hundred years on and there is now an artistic marriage between man and nature.
